I think this is disney & pixar's masterpiece - Finding Nemo Reviews

Before "Finding Nemo" begins, we wonder if we're going to experience as much magic as we did when we first saw "Toy Story", and then went on to see other great films like "Toy Story 2", "A Bug's Life", and "Monster's Inc.". When "Finding Nemo" finally does begin, we've already seen enough magic to make us cry. I think this is Disney & Pixar's masterpiece. The film begins with two clown fish gazing from their anemone home. Marlin (Albert Brooks) and his wife Coral seem like the happiest couple, seemingly about to start the perfect life. But when a Barracuda appears and attacks, Marlin awakes from blacking out only to discover that Coral is gone and so are all of his un-hatched eggs. Well, all except one. Remembering that Coral wanted to name one of the babies Nemo, he gives the baby that name, but Marlin doesn't want to lose Nemo either, so from then on he becomes an over-protective father to Nemo. On Nemo's first day of school, Marlin becomes so overrun with fear for Nemo, and Nemo (Alexander Gould) is dared by some other fish to swim across the deep part of the ocean. Marlin catches up and the father and son get in a fight. Suddenly some divers appear and Nemo is snatched away. Marlin tries desperately to find the divers' motorboat, but he fails to catch up with it. Then Marlin bumps into a blue fish named Dory (Ellen Degeneres) who claims that she knows where the boat is. But when Marlin tries following her, she begins to act strange, and she explains later that it's because she suffers from short-term memory loss. Dory and Marlin find one of the diver's masks, and though Dory is getting on his nerves, Marling finds out that she can read the human language, and she's suddenly able to memorize tha address on the mask, even through her constant memory loss. Together Marlin and Dory face many obstacles on their journey through the ocean, including: encountering vegetarian sharks, being chased by a monstrous fish in the abyss, swimming through a school of jellyfish, getting stuck in a whale, and riding in the mouth of a pelican named Nigel (Geoffrey Rush). Meanwhile, Nemo is far away in a fish tank in a dentist's office somewhere in Sydney, Australia. There, Nemo befriends the other creatures in the tank led by a fish named Gill (Willem Dafoe), and with the help of them, Nemo begins planning escapes from the tank, and he'll have to escape quick, before the dentist's careless niece Darla takes him home with her! Albert Brooks is splendid as Marlin, and Ellen Degeneres, who was obviously born to play Dory, steals the show with her outstanding performace. These are two marvelous actors playing two remarkable fish. "Shark Tale" was just released into theaters, but it looks disappointing after what the critics have rated it overall. That would be a shame if it's really as bad as people say it is, even though I understand why it wouldn't be as good as "Finding Nemo", because the critics have said that it's got "Godfather" type jokes, which little kids probably wouldn't understand. "Finding Nemo" is a huge delight. When first seen it looks like a movie you'd want to watch over and over again, but believe me, you'll get used to it after about 4 times. I don't like the fact that Pixar probably isn't working with Disney anymore (their last film, "The Incredibles, is soon to come out), but who knows? Maybe they'll reunite one day. And "Finding Nemo" is Disney and Pixar's greatest achievement ever.

Sea-ing is believing - Finding Nemo Reviews

After raising the quality of computer-generated animation with the Toy Story franchise, A Bug's Life and Monsters, Inc., the animation maestros at Pixar have outdone themselves. Forget about being a great kids movie--Finding Nemo is just a great movie. When a wet-behind-the-fins clown fish, Nemo (Alexander Gould), flexes his independence in the face of his overprotective dad, Marlin (Albert Brooks), he's captured and delivered into a dentist's aquarium. Marlin and his new fishy pal Dory (Ellen DeGeneres, who gets all the best lines) go in search of the lost little guy. They travel across an ocean full of wild characters, as the writing embraces Brooks' silly neuroses and lets no fish joke get away. Stuffed to the gills with smart humor, crystal-clear animation and a touching story, Nemo is the catch of the summer. There are 3.7 trillion fish in the ocean*, they're looking for one.

You have to find this! - Finding Nemo Reviews

It's a strange sensation knowing that Pixar has made such an excellent film out of something that could have easily been terrible. And perhaps that's one of the reasons I embrace this film so full-heartedly. This tale of a lost little clownfish at first sounds like a tale only enjoyable to 5-year-olds, but is as engaging to adults with it's genuine humor and pure emotional content. Very rare indeed that a CG character is able to express themselves fully, not to mention this comes from a CG fish. Finding Nemo is a tale about Nemo, a young clownfish (and sole survivor of a barracuda attack when he was still a larve) and his father Marlin (voiced by the amazing Albert Brooks). Marlin is worrier, constantly being overprotective of his son for the slightest things (I don't have to tell you that Nemo is getting more and more fed up by it as he is growing up). It is when Nemo is on a field trip to the edge of the reef that Nemo is taken by a couple of scuba divers. Marlin chases right after, but is no match keeping up with a boat. It is then that he meets Dory (played with incredible zeal by Ellen Degeneres), a blue fish with a serious problem. The two of them take on sharks, jellyfish, meet turtles and whales as they journey to Sydney to find Nemo. It is hard to find only one thing about this film that is remarkable. In fact, I cannot find any flaws in this timeless tale that equals in range and depth as The Lion King. The characters are fully rendered with emotional ranges that make them more believable than most real human beings. Albert Brooks and Ellen Degeneres lead an incredible cast of voice actors. Andrew Stanton directs the animation with an eye of fantastic realism. The color schemes are brilliant and brings the palate to life. Not to mention that this film has no villan, even the scuba diver (a dentist by profession) thinks he was doing the little fish a favor by bringing him back to the aquarium at his workplace. It's these little touches that make a lasting difference between a good film and a perfect film. Finding Nemo is a classic example of a PERFECT FILM.

A better disney than seen for a while - Finding Nemo Reviews

What makes this tacky story so wonderful? Love. A father's love for his son. A father just like me, overprotective, but loving. We understand Merlin's quirks. Nemo is harder to identify with though Dory is a hoot. Artistically it rates with the better Disney's, the last great one being Beauty and the Beast (I know the Lion King came after B&B, but I didn't like it). For once, the kid isn't the all smart one and the parent the idiot. Since when did parents get so stupid. In every Disney movie the parents are either dead, evil or just plain old incompetent. Here's one where none fully apply. Nemo's mother is gone, but Dad is here, alive and kicking. What else powers the movie is love. Not romance, but love. True, family love. Love that will cast out fear, to quote from the God, the creator of the universe. Love which is not interested in kissing or screwing, but love that is sacrificing, serving and insane. The parents love for a child, who can explain it. Finding Nemo far from explains it, but it reveals it. Its the love that continues to put out posters for a missing child, years after she/he disappears. Its the love the cries to sleep at night at the trouble of the wayward child. Its the love that forgives the defiance that caused the hurt and works to heal the wound, to repair the breach, to make it all better. Love that we haven't seen in hollywood for a long, long time. (and aren't likely to see for yet another long long time.). In Nemo a child's disobedience proved disasterous. A father's resourcefulness, wisdom fueled by love, saved the day. And the Father too learned, that the child needs a little freedom and must take reasonable risks. Good show Disney. Do it again.

Finding nemo - Finding Nemo Reviews

I'm sorry if I disappoint anyone, but Pixar are not the gods that everyone believes they are. Pixar released a very flawed movie with Finding Nemo, and the reason it surpassed Lion King financially makes no sense to me. First off, yes, it is a good movie. I like it. But not so much that I would give it an A, and I don't think it should receive an A compared to other movies in the genre that have received A's. Lion King deserved an A. Toy Story and its sequel deserve an A. And Monsters Inc. deserved an A. But this movie is a B. The plot line is sufficient, at best. And I can hardly find any character in any of the characters. Marlin is completely predictable, Dora gets a grin from you at best, Nemo is typically passive, and the only characters I really found remotely interesting were the twitchy sharks and the rad turtle. I have no bias against Pixar. I have in fact loved every pixar/disney movie that have come out and would willingly throw a million A's at them. But Finding Nemo lacks a foundation of warmth and awareness of the audience. From the typical storyline, to, even worse, the impersonal characters, I find it hard to give Finding Nemo the A that it has been bestowed.

149 words of praise for ellen degeneres - Finding Nemo Reviews

I've not yet written a full review for this amazing latest film from Pixar, which may be their best ever. I do, however, want to single out Ellen Degeneres, who shines through like a comedy superstar as Dorie. Pixar gave her full license, obviously, to improv and just be herself, and they animated around her, and it was faith well invested. Somehow, taking on the guise of a fish allows Ellen's hilariously self-conscious stream-of-consciousness personality to shine, separated and independent of her many other comedic efforts over the years, which unfortunately, were ultimately forced to focus on elements of her personal life which are interesting with the historic context of her career, but not as funny as Dorie, the well-intentioned fish with lots of love and few brain cells. Like Eddie Murphy, who struggles to find acceptance in other fields but is a blockbuster star in movies like 'Shrek,' Ms. Degeneres appears to have hit a home run as a family-friendly voice actor.
